  Quorum -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
When quorum is not met, a legislative body cannot hold a vote, and cannot change the status quo.
A quorum in a legislative body is normally a majority of the entire membership of the body.
The technique of the disappearing quorum (refusing to vote although physically present on the floor), was used by the minority to block votes in the US House of Representatives until 1890.

 Art. 11. Miscellaneous. 64. A Quorum   (Site not responding. Last check: 2007-11-04)
The quorum of a body of delegates, unless the bylaws provide for a smaller quorum, is a majority of the number enrolled as attending the convention, not those appointed.
In the absence of a quorum such an assembly may order a call of the house [41] and thus compel attendance of absentees, or it may adjourn, providing for an adjourned meeting if it pleases.
Where the quorum is so small it has been found necessary to require notice of all bills, amendments, etc., to be given in advance; and even in Congress, with its large quorum, one day’s notice has to be given of any motion to rescind or change any rule or standing order.

 Quorum of Members   (Site not responding. Last check: 2007-11-04)
A quorum of the membership is usually defined in the CCandRs and/or bylaws as 50%, 51%, or a simple majority of the members.
If a quorum is not present, the members at the meeting may adjourn the meeting to a later date but may not conduct any other business.
Members at a duly called meeting at which a quorum is present may continue to transact business notwithstanding the withdrawal of enough members to leave less than a quorum.

 Dictionary.com/Word of the Day Archive/quorum
Such a number of the officers or members of any body as is legally competent to transact business.
The extraordinary powers of the Senate were vested in twenty-six men, fourteen of whom would constitute a quorum, of which eight would make up a majority.
Quorum comes from the Latin quorum, "of whom," from qui, "who." The term arose from the wording of the commission once issued to justices of the peace in England, by which commission it was directed that no business of certain kinds should be done without the presence of one or more specially designated justices.

 THE QUORUM
The Quorum allowed the social gathering of Blacks and Whites, who sat together at tables in the coffee house, when Blacks and Whites were forbidden by State law to sit together at tables in restaurants and bars.
In the politically and racially charged atmosphere of the 1960s, the Quorum was a haven for open-minded individuals who wanted to assert such values as freedom of speech and the rights of free association.
The Quorum's founding group decided to try the same strategy in reverse: they would be a private club, only they would consider anyone who walked in the door to be a member.
